#2ff8a8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ff8a8 is composed of 18.4% red, 97.3%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.3%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 156.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 57.8%. #2ff8a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#00f151.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#2ff8a8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2ff8a8 has RGB values of R:47, G:248,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3143848.

Hex triplet 2ff8a8 #2ff8a8
RGB Decimal 47, 248, 168 rgb(47,248,168)
RGB Percent 18.4, 97.3, 65.9 rgb(18.4%,97.3%,65.9%)
CMYK 81, 0, 32, 3
HSL 156.1°, 93.5, 57.8 hsl(156.1,93.5%,57.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 156.1°, 81, 97.3
Web Safe 33ff99 #33ff99
CIE-LAB 87.272, -64.891, 25.355
XYZ 41.804, 70.562, 48.46
xyY 0.26, 0.439, 70.562
CIE-LCH 87.272, 69.669, 158.658
CIE-LUV 87.272, -72.151, 47.082
Hunter-Lab 84.001, -58.169, 24.596
Binary 00101111, 11111000, 10101000

Shades and Tints of #2ff8a8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ff8a8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929594 is the less saturated color, while #2ff8a8 is the most saturated one.
